Forecast: Mental and Behavioural Disorders Mortality in Canada

The mortality rate due to mental and behavioral disorders among Canadian females is projected to increase steadily from 2024 to 2028. The data shows a consistent upward trend with a percentage increase year-on-year: 2024 to 2025 sees approximately a 2.99% rise, followed by a 2.85% increase from 2025 to 2026, a 2.73% rise from 2026 to 2027, and about a 2.55% growth in 2027 to 2028. Analyzing the five-year period ending in 2028, the compound annual growth rate (CAGR) suggests a moderate upward trend in mortality rates.
